testIT (Pvt) Ltd., is the sole Licensee for Sri Lanka andMaldives for all qualifications offered by ECDL Foundation, operating as ICDLSri Lanka.
As the sole local business promoter and distributor for this territory, testIT’s responsibilities include creating goodwill in the ICDL concept, marketing and promoting all ECDL Foundation qualifications, and liaising with Government Bodies/ Agencies and the Test Centres.
How can I get certified? | The ICDL is awarded upon completion of 7 Modules ranging from essential concepts of IT, word-processing and spreadsheets to using Email and the internet. Through this modular structure, the ICDL provides a flexible learning approach. The ICDL 7Modules - Concepts of Information and Communication Technology
- Using the Computer and managing files
- Word processing
- Spreadsheets
- Database
- Presentation
- Information and Communication
The above Modules may be taken in any order and within the span of three years from the data of the first test. All modules, except the first one, are manifestations of practical skills. The tests are tasks-oriented and are typical of day-to-day computer operations. Click for Details >> | |
Test Centre Approval Guidelines | A centre MUST be formally Approved by the ECDL Foundation or its Local Accreditation Agent to be able to conduct ICDL tests within their premises. The Test Centre Approval process ensures that the centre’s testing environment and staff has met the standards set internationally. All ICDL tests conducted are automated and the centre must check that its operating environment meets the technical requirements.
Tests can be administered On-Line or LAN based, centres should ensure that they do have internet connectivity at a minimum of 56kbps. Click to Continue >> |

The International Computer Driving Licensee (ICDL) is a global programme aiming at raising the general level of competence in IT in all sectors of the society and, therefore, Promoting life-long e-learning. The programme's main objective is to establish a benchmark for basic computer skills giving the opportunity for the Sri Lankan population to effectively join the new information age and consequently leading to fulfilling the ultimate objective of computer literacy. The ICDL concept is owned by the ECDL Foundation, which is a non-profit organization based in Dublin, Ireland. The Foundation was formed to coordinate the introduction and cooperation of the ECDL Concept throughout the world through a network of licensees. testIT (Pvt) Ltd.,, is the ICDL licensee for Sri Lanka and Maldives.
